1. Motor Architecture & Electromagnetic Efficiency

At the core of any high-torque kitchen mixer grinder is its motor design. As a premier manufacturer established since 1990, our R&D division prioritizes 100% Grade-A Electrolytic Copper Winding over cheaper Copper-Clad Aluminum (CCA) alternatives. Pure copper wiring offers vastly lower electrical resistance ($1.68 \times 10^{-8} \, \Omega \cdot \text{m}$), minimizing $I^2R$ resistive heating losses and enabling sustained high-torque output under dense food loads (e.g., tough spices, dry grains, and viscous batter blending).

Heavy-Duty Motors (500W–1200W)

Configured with Class F and Class H insulation systems rated up to 155°C and 180°C breakdown thresholds. Equipped with dual ball-bearing assemblies to reduce rotational friction and mechanical wear.

Thermal Overload Protection (OLP)

Integrated bimetallic snap-action overload circuit breakers automatically cut power when current draw exceeds safe operational limits, preventing stator burnouts during prolonged stall conditions.

Advanced Air-Flow Cooling

Aerodynamically engineered motor housing with high-velocity internal cooling impellers ensures rapid heat dissipation, allowing a continuous duty cycle of 30+ minutes without thermal degradation.

2. Jar Metallurgy, Flow-Breaker Dynamics & Blade Geometry

The efficiency of pulverization depends equally on jar hydrodynamics. Our manufacturing lines utilize deep-drawn AISI 304 Food-Grade Stainless Steel for all grinding vessels, offering superior resistance to organic acids, impact forces, and stress corrosion cracking.

Unlike flat-walled jars that allow ingredients to ride up the sides without contact, our engineered jars incorporate precision internal flow breakers. These vertical ridges interrupt vortex flow, continuously forcing the mixture downward back into the primary cutting arc of the high-speed blades. Blades are manufactured from AISI 420 hardened stainless steel, cold-stamped and diamond-ground to achieve razor-sharp bevel angles that maintain edge retention over thousands of grinding cycles.

Jar Material Grade & Safety Compliance

All plastic lids and handles are injection-molded using virgin BPA-free Polycarbonate (PC) and Polypropylene (PP). High-grade food-safe silicone gaskets prevent leakage during high-speed wet processing, meeting EU 10/2011 and US FDA 21 CFR standards.

Vibration & Acoustic Dampening

Base units feature shock-absorbing elastomer feet and dynamic motor balancing to suppress operational vibration, reducing noise levels below 78 dB under maximum load—a crucial requirement for modern residential and commercial environments.

Global Sourcing & Procurement Trends (2025–2030)

Key market shifts driving B2B procurement decisions for small appliances across North America, Europe, the Middle East, and Asia-Pacific.

TREND 01

Transition to BLDC & Smart Motors

Global buyers are increasingly demanding Brushless DC (BLDC) motors in premium appliance lines. BLDC technology delivers up to 40% higher energy efficiency, precise variable speed control, silent operation, and longer service life compared to traditional universal motors.

TREND 02

Unified Multi-Market Certification

Importers require streamlined factory compliance. Modern manufacturing lines must support plug-and-play production certified across multiple standards, including CE, CB, ETL, GS, RoHS, SASO, and BIS, reducing time-to-market for multi-region retail launches.

TREND 03

Eco-Conscious Packaging & Repairability

ESG mandates are driving the elimination of EPS foam in transit packaging. B2B buyers favor manufacturers offering 100% recyclable molded pulp packaging alongside modular component replacement programs (swappable blade assemblies and couplers).
